A nine-year-old Dutch girl survived Wednesday's crash of an Afriqiyah Airways plane that killed 105 people, a Tripoli airport spokesman said.

Theu00a0Libyan commercial aircraft carrying 105 people, including 94 passengers and 11 crew members, crashed Wednesday at Tripoli airport, Al-Jazeera television reported.

The plane crashed on the runway while making its landing approach. All passengers and crew are believed to be dead.

A Tripoli airport spokesman said the plane was arriving on a flight from South Africa.

The cause of the crash was not immediately known.
